Circle

Circle is the most important and widely used geometric symbol. It has no beginning and no end, no direction or orientation. In mystical tradition, the circle is the symbol of God, the ever-present center, complete and unassailable. This is the reason that the circle is the symbol of heaven and everything spiritual. For several mystical cultures, circles are considered protection against evil spirits and used to be drawn around a person performing an exorcism. Nobody is allowed to step into the circle. Some feng shui disciplines enclose unfavorable numbers inside a circle in order to limit and neutralize their influence. In astrology, a circle with a dot in the center is the symbol of the sun. In alchemy, the circle is the ana¬logue for the metal gold. In Christianity, a halo is usually a perfect circle; concentric circles are a sign of creation, similar to those created on the surface of the water when a stone is thrown in the water. The Chinese yin yang symbol expresses its duality in a circle. In Zen Buddhism, a circle means enlightenment. Because of its shape, a connection is created to everything that approaches a circle. The circle acts as a balancing force when people try to solve problems. Decisions are made at a round table. Even in traffic designs, a circle is used to harmoniously connect several streets from different directions and allow traffic to flow smoothly.
